COLUMBIA, Mo. – University of Missouri softball (18-6, 0-2 SEC) will host No. 14/12 Northwestern, Stanford and Ball State for the Mizzou Classic from March 18-20. The No. 18/17 Tigers are scheduled to play five games over three days with each game streaming live on SECN+.

Mizzou returns to action after a Braggin’ Rights sweep on the road at Illinois. The Tigers took game one in extra innings after Kendyll Bailey drove in Casidy Chaumont for the game winning run in the eighth inning. Brooke Wilmes and Casidy Chaumont led the Tigers to a run-rule victory in the second game.

SCHEDULE UPDATE

Friday’s Mizzou Classic schedule has been adjusted. Ball State will face Northwestern at 2 p.m. on Friday afternoon and Mizzou will take on Ball State at 4:30, following the conclusion of the first game of the day. Mizzou’s Friday game with Northwestern will not be played. The Tigers will take on the Wildcats in the previously scheduled Sunday matchup. 

THE LEADOFF

Brooke Wilmes has again put together a productive season. She homered three times over two games against Illinois, including her first career multi-home run game.

Wilmes is now among the top ten in program history in hits, runs, doubles, home runs and RBI. She is currently tied for the team lead with eight home runs.

ON THE DALY

Kara Daly has hit seven home runs over her last eight games. The freshman became the first player in program history to homer in five-straight games after her solo shot against Tennessee. She homered twice against Illinois for her first multi-home run game.

WERT ALERT

Kimberly Wert is one home run away from breaking the Mizzou all-time home run record. She is tied with Jen Bruck with 47 home runs over her career.

Wert also hit five home runs in her freshman year at Hofstra. Over her entire collegiate career she has hit 52 homers.  

CHAU-TIME

Casidy Chaumont leads the Tigers with a .423 batting average while smashing five doubles, a triple, four home runs and 17 RBI. Her slugging percentage of .788 leads the team. Chaumont has matched her career high of four RBI in a single game three times in 2022.
